Transaction 29124d6b7ceb8b52da5243d4477e86342159d3a5043d93fb13eb859319965bed

2 Input
2 Outputs
  • 29124d6b7ceb8b52da5243d4477e86342159d3a5043d93fb13eb859319965bed:0
  • value  1186892
    address  17SRuggTpW63LuVQXZ3s5ceZWLFvzwE5eE
  • 29124d6b7ceb8b52da5243d4477e86342159d3a5043d93fb13eb859319965bed:1
  • value  12720419
    address  3MeX9FShfiAE1d7xftW4xNJkPXxnTx11Hp